Let's discuss the value of the SCA barista certificate. SCA, the International Barista Association, is a long-standing and globally recognized authority in the coffee industry. The barista certificate it issues represents the holder's professional skills and qualities in coffee making, tasting, equipment management, etc. This certificate not only represents the professional level of the barista, but is also a strong proof of his or her professional competitiveness.

In the highly competitive coffee industry, having an SCA certificate means that you have certain professional advantages, which is not only reflected in the improvement of personal skills, but also in the broad space for career development. Baristas with SCA certificates often have more job opportunities and higher salaries. This certificate can also have a positive impact on your reputation and reputation in the coffee industry, helping you to establish a solid position in the industry.

High value also means high threshold. To obtain the SCA barista certificate, you need to undergo rigorous training and assessment. The training content covers coffee making skills, tasting skills, coffee equipment operation and other aspects, aiming to comprehensively improve the students' professional quality, and the assessment is a strict test of the students' actual skills. Only students who truly possess professional standards can pass the assessment and obtain the certificate.

How much does the SCA barista certificate cost? This mainly depends on the training method and institution you choose. If you choose to participate in the officially certified training institution for systematic learning, the cost is usually higher, but you can also get more professional and comprehensive training. If you choose to self-study and participate in a separate skill assessment, the cost will be relatively low, but in any case, you need to invest a certain amount of money and time to improve your professional skills.

It is worth mentioning that although the SCA certificate is highly recognized in the coffee industry, it is not the only correct way or standard for making coffee. When choosing a training institution and course content, you should combine your own interests and career planning to choose a learning path that suits you.
